Overview

Sheikh Rasik Stadium in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ates, served as a prominent venue for Twenty20 International cricket between 2010 and 2019. The ground hosted its first T20I match on 26 October 2010 and concluded its run of fixtures with a game on 27 October 2019. Over this nine-year period, the stadium recorded a total of 41 T20I matches, establishing itself as a key location for international cricket in the Middle East.

The venue witnessed significant statistical extremes during its active years. The highest team total recorded at Sheikh Rasik Stadium was 189/3, achieved by Scotland on 14 January 2017. In contrast, the lowest team total was 66/9, posted by Nigeria on 26 October 2019. These figures highlight the varying conditions and competitive balance present across the different fixtures held at the ground.

Individual performances also stood out in the cricket statistics for this venue. Shaiman Anwar recorded the highest individual batting score with 117 runs on 14 April 2017. On the bowling front, Rohan Mustafa achieved the best bowling figures with 6/18 on 19 October 2019. These records remain the benchmarks for individual excellence at the stadium during the specified period.

Oman emerged as the most active team at Sheikh Rasik Stadium, participating in 10 matches during the venue's T20I history. This frequency of play underscores the ground's importance for the Omani cricket team and its role in hosting regional and international opponents.
